Core Features and Functions

Hinge lever micro switches are characterized by their unique operation mechanism, which involves a lever arm attached to a hinge. This design allows for greater mechanical advantage, resulting in a low actuation force that contributes to longer lifecycle reliability. These micro switches typically feature:

  • Compact Design: Their small stature enables placement in space-constrained environments without compromising functionality.
  • High Durability: Many hinge lever micro switches are rated for millions of operations, thus ideal for applications requiring consistent performance.
  • Versatile Applications: They can be used in a variety of environments, from harsh industrial setups to sensitive consumer electronics.

With these advanced features, hinge lever micro switches stand as a preferred choice in precision control applications.

Advantages and Application Scenarios

The benefits of hinge lever micro switches extend beyond basic functionality. Their design allows for a range of advantages:

  • Cost-Effective Solution: By providing reliable performance at a lower cost than alternative switching technologies, hinge lever micro switches are appealing for manufacturers looking to optimize their production costs.
  • Enhanced Safety: With their fail-safe operation, these switches enhance the safety of machinery and electronic devices.
  • Wide Range of Ratings: Available in various actuation forces, thermal ratings, and electrical ratings (e.g., from 5A up to 15A at 250V AC), they cater to diverse user requirements.

Typical applications include:

  • Automotive Applications: Hinge lever micro switches are employed in seat belt alarms, light control systems, and other safety features in vehicles.
  • Home Appliances: They can be found in washing machines, microwave ovens, and dishwashers, where reliable control mechanisms are essential.
  • Industrial Equipment: In factories and warehouses, these switches are integral to equipment such as conveyor belts and robotics.
